summaryrefslogtreecommitdiff
path: root/README.md
diff options
context:
space:
mode:
authorfengweihao <[email protected]>2018-06-21 09:56:02 +0800
committerfengweihao <[email protected]>2018-06-21 09:56:02 +0800
commit8cfaa483e14aeb791a44d1587d08d28678d66152 (patch)
tree680d8699e40fed08088455647e5c4b06a5cb64d3 /README.md
parent130ee58a154c2ec9a40becfcd3284e5b4024670a (diff)
[Add]
1.添加README文件
Diffstat (limited to 'README.md')
-rw-r--r--README.md24
1 files changed, 24 insertions, 0 deletions
diff --git a/README.md b/README.md
new file mode 100644
index 0000000..7178d1d
--- /dev/null
+++ b/README.md
@@ -0,0 +1,24 @@
+[目录层次介绍]
+1. conf 配置文件目录
+2. make Makefile配置文件目录
+3. release 执行make tarball后生成的安装包文件
+4. src 源代码目录
+5. ca 根证书目录
+src/components 使用的静态库所需的头文件(libevent、openssl、hiredis)
+src/inc 系统所需头文件
+src/lib 静态库
+src/package 安装包临时目录
+src/rt 公共函数
+
+[编译运行]
+1. cd src && make
+2. ./cert_store --normal<--normal|--daemon>
+备注:
+发送请求命令:curl -X GET "x.x.x.x:9995/ca?host="www.qq.com"&flag=1&valid=1" -m 30 -v
+使用--daemon运行时,配置文件中使用绝对路径
+
+[安装包使用]
+1. cd src && make tarball
+2. cd release
+3. tar -zxvf cert_store-1.0.1.0.tar.gz
+4. cd cert_store-1.0.1.0 && make install \ No newline at end of file